I applied through a recruiter. The process took 2 days. I interviewed at L'Oréal (Fayetteville, AR) in Oct 2015
Interview
I met with recruiters at the career fair. After speaking with a recruiter for a couple of minutes, she brought me to the side for a mini-interview. She asked about my leadership experience and a general overview of my engineering experience. I was then invited for another interview the next day. There were two rounds back to back, 3:1. That night they offered me the position.
